In today's fast-paced digital world, the spread of misinformation and fake news has become a significant challenge. The importance of ensuring the accuracy and credibility of news sources has never been more crucial. This is where Attestation and certification come into play, especially in a city like San Francisco known for its progressive values and tech-savvy population. Attestation and certification in the context of news media refer to the process of verifying the accuracy and reliability of news content through trusted third-party sources. This could involve fact-checking organizations, media watchdogs, or independent verification services. By undergoing attestation and obtaining certification, news outlets can demonstrate their commitment to upholding journalistic integrity and providing the public with reliable information. San Francisco, as a hub of innovation and technology, is at the forefront of exploring new ways to combat misinformation and ensure truth in news. One approach that has gained traction in the city is the use of blockchain technology for verifying news stories. Blockchain, with its decentralized and transparent nature, can provide a secure platform for storing and verifying information, making it harder for false news to spread unchecked. Additionally, some news organizations in San Francisco have started partnering with fact-checking initiatives and independent auditors to validate their reporting practices. By voluntarily subjecting themselves to external scrutiny, these media outlets are showing their dedication to accuracy and transparency. But it's not just news organizations that can benefit from attestation and certification. Social media platforms, which have become major sources of news for many people, can also play a role in promoting truth in news. By implementing mechanisms for verifying the authenticity of news content and penalizing misinformation, these platforms can help curb the spread of fake news. Ultimately, attestation and certification for truth in news are essential tools in the fight against misinformation. In a city like San Francisco, where technology and media intersect in unique ways, embracing these practices can lead to a more informed and empowered public. By holding news sources accountable and promoting transparency, we can ensure that the information we consume is reliable and trustworthy.
